In your place, I would check out the Lenovo T series laptop. T420/430 etc. I used one for work and it really take up abuse pretty well.
I run it around 12 hours a day and temperature is pretty reasonable. Sound though, I feel is below par.
 
The Thinkpad x220 (if you are a thinkpad purist) with intel second gen sandy bridge cpus or the x230 with intel third gen cpus. It has everything that the T series has and it has an IPS panel option and a phenomenal runtime of 24 hours continuously if you use the 9 cell battery with a 19 cell slice battery(ultrabase3)

My x220 bought in dec 2011 is loaded to the gills with the following config :-
i7 2620|16gb ddr3 gskill 1333mhz|Msata ssd 64 GB (OS)|wd500lpvt 500gb hdd|12.5" display @ 1366x768 + 720p webcam|9 cell battery|win 7 pro 64 bit
I am on tour 15-20 days in a month and the x220 has been manhandled at airports across the country. I use it as my office laptop (rejected the dell my company gave me). It lasts me 8-9 hours on a single charge with no battery saving options enabled after 18 months since its purchase. it has the best keyboard of any laptop ever made. I have had 2 massive bike accidents and numerous tiny ones and the laptop is unscathed. It is by far the best gadget I have ever owned or will probably own since lenovo ruined the design of the thinkpad with the x230.
